8ef3805f1b pcm: hw: Call USER_PVERSION ioctl at open
Up from the new PCM protocol 2.0.14, user-space can inform the
protocol version it supports to kernel, so that the kernel may switch
its behavior depending on it.  Add this ioctl call in the PCM hw
plugin at opening.

The patch contains also the addition of SNDRV_PCM_INFO_SYNC_APPLPTR
carried from the upstream kernel commit 42f945970af9 ("ALSA: pcm: Add
the explicit appl_ptr sync support"), as well as the trivial change
(an addition of comma) to sync with the kernel asound.h.

85e4704151 pcm: Provide a CLOCK_MONOTONIC_RAW timestamp type
For applications which need to synchronise with external timebases such
as broadcast TV applications the kernel monotonic time is not optimal as
it includes adjustments from NTP and so may still include discontinuities
due to that. A raw monotonic time which does not include any adjustments
is available in the kernel from getrawmonotonic() so provide userspace with
a new timestamp type SNDRV_PCM_TSTAMP_TYPE_MONOTONIC_RAW which provides
timestamps based on this as an option.

2b49df0c55 pcm: fix 64-bit SNDRV_PCM_IOCTL_STATUS ABI breakage
Commit cf40ea169a (pcm: support for audio timestamps) added the new
audio_tstamp field to struct sndrv_pcm_status.  However, struct timespec
requires 64-bit alignment, so the 64-bit compiler would insert
32 bits of padding before this field, which broke SNDRV_PCM_IOCTL_STATUS
with error messages like this:

      kernel: unknown ioctl = 0x80984120

To solve this, insert the padding explicitly so that it can be taken
into account when calculating the ABI structure size.

cf40ea169a pcm: support for audio timestamps
add new snd_pcm_status_get_audio_htstamp() routine to
query the audio timestamps provided by the kernel.

This change provides applications with better ways
to track elapsed time. Before this patch, applications
would subtract queued samples (delay) from written samples,
resulting in a 1-2 sample error.

Also add snd_pcm_hw_params_supports_audio_wallclock_ts()
to query what the hardware supports.

c821f2e7f2 Fix off_t in kernel struct
The off_t in kernel struct (for ioctls) is actually different from the
definition of user-space off_t.  The kernel off_t is equial with long
while user-space off_t depends on the large-file support.
